Elif Ulaş

Gamze Elif Ulaş (born February 26, 1986) is a Turkish figure skater, ice hockey player and member of Turkish national women's ice hockey team. She playing forward.
Elif Ulaş became second in the juniors category at the 2001 Turkey Figure Skating Championships,〔 〕 and participated at international ice skating events such as Golden Bear of Zagreb and Copenhagen Trophy in figure skating branch.〔(Ice skating website ) 〕
She scored Turkey's first ever goal in the match against Estonia (1-14) on March 27, 2007 during the Women's World Ice Hockey Championships, Group IV held in Miercurea Ciuc, Romania.〔(Ice Hockey Federation 2007 Championship )〕 Elif Ulaş is a member of Milenyum Paten SK in Ankara.
